Tigers Cruise to Exhibition Win Over Fisk

TSU Tigers Show New Look in Win Over Fisk

 

The Tennessee State Tigers jumped out to a 9-0 lead and never looked back as they overwhelmed inter-city rival Fisk 101-69 at Gentry Center in Nashville.


The Tigers got double-digit scoring from 6-0 freshman guard Gerald Robinson, Jr. (23 pts), 6-9 junior Jerrell Houston (14 pts), 7-0 sophomore center James Craft (14 pts) and 6-8 freshman forward Stephen Evans (10 pts). Houston also added eleven rebounds to pick up a double-double on the night.

TSU used a trapping defense to build a 40-25 lead at halftime and showed a variety of high-flying dunks over the shorter Division III Bulldogs from Fisk. Veteran guards Bruce Price and Reiley dished out six assists each while Craft and Houston recorded 3 and 2 blocks, respectively.

The Tigers hot 55.6% from the floor (48-81) and 40% from beyond the 3-point arc (6-15). TSU's defense held Fisk to 40.6% shooting from the floor and just 33.3% from beyond the arc.

Tennessee State will play Carson-Newman University in another exhibition game in Nashville on Wednesday night (11/07). Tip-off is set for 7:30p at the Gentry Center.
